CLEMSON, SC — Clemson junior David Dannelly finished tied for 13th out of 312 players during the 36-hole stroke play qualifying tournament at two courses in the state of Washington on Monday and Tuesday. He will be one of 64 players in the match play championship that will begin Wednesday at Chambers Bay Golf Club in University Place, WA.
Dannelly shot rounds of 72 on each course, the Home Course on Monday and Chambers Bay on Tuesday. He had four birdies and 10 pars during each round. Dannelly will play Byeong-Hun An of the University of California in the first round beginning at 2:00 PM eastern. Byeong-Hun An defeated Clemson’s Ben Martin in the championship match of the 2009 United States Amateur
Clemson junior Jacob Burger finished in a tie for 59th in the stroke play qualifier with rounds of 73 at The Home Course and 76 at Chambers Bay for a 149 total. He was one of 16 players competing for the final six spots in the match play championship tournament during a playoff Wednesday morning, but he failed to advance.
